Biloxi Stormwater Management Planning Ordinance

This Biloxi ordinance establishes procedures for maintaining a pattern of land uses and development that will reduce natural disaster vulnerability, assure water quality standards, protect habitat, including wetlands, and maintain the value of public and private infrastructure. These procedures include stormwater pollution prevention plans that verify compliance with federal, state, and local stormwater management regulations.
